
Fatal CHP Shooting: Pedestrian Uses Taser on Officer in LA Freeway Struggle
The California Highway Patrol (CHP) has provided additional details about a deadly officer-involved shooting on the 105 Freeway in Lynwood. The CHP stated that the man involved in the incident, who died after being shot, had used a Taser against the officer during a struggle. The officer, fearing for his safety, fired his service weapon multiple times. The incident began with reports of a man walking on the freeway, and videos posted on social media show the officer and the man struggling before the shooting occurred. The California Department of Justice is investigating the incident, and the officer has been placed on administrative leave.
